Canon SX20 IS vs Ricoh WG-30 Overview
Here is a extended analysis of the Canon SX20 IS vs Ricoh WG-30, one being a Small Sensor Superzoom and the latter is a Waterproof by competitors Canon and Ricoh. There is a crucial difference among the sensor resolutions of the SX20 IS (12MP) and WG-30 (16MP) but both cameras posses the same sensor dimensions (1/2.3").

The SX20 IS was unveiled 5 years earlier than the WG-30 and that is a fairly serious gap as far as camera tech is concerned. Both of these cameras have different body design with the Canon SX20 IS being a SLR-like (bridge) camera and the Ricoh WG-30 being a Compact camera.

Canon SX20 IS vs Ricoh WG-30 Physical Comparison
For anybody who is looking to carry your camera regularly, you will have to consider its weight and size. The Canon SX20 IS provides exterior measurements of 128mm x 88mm x 87mm (5.0" x 3.5" x 3.4") accompanied by a weight of 600 grams (1.32 lbs) while the Ricoh WG-30 has specifications of 123mm x 62mm x 30mm (4.8" x 2.4" x 1.2") having a weight of 192 grams (0.42 lbs).

Canon SX20 IS vs Ricoh WG-30 Sensor Comparison
Usually, it is difficult to see the gap in sensor sizing simply by going through specifications. The graphic underneath will help provide you a much better sense of the sensor sizing in the SX20 IS and WG-30.
Plainly, both the cameras provide the same sensor dimensions albeit not the same resolution. You should count on the Ricoh WG-30 to produce more detail having an extra 4 Megapixels. Higher resolution will also help you crop pictures more aggressively. The older SX20 IS will be disadvantaged with regard to sensor tech.
